98,039 Hits in 6.7 sec

Demand-based schedulability analysis for real-time multi-core scheduling

Jinkyu Lee, Insik Shin
2014 Journal of Systems and Software  
until Zero-Laxity) and LLF (Least Laxity First), which are known to be effective for real-time multi-core scheduling.  ...  However, such a potential is not yet fully realized for real-time multi-core scheduling mainly due to (i) the difficulty of calculating the resource demand under dynamic priority scheduling algorithms  ...  For tighter schedulability analysis on multi-cores, we focus on the demand-based schedulability analysis method (Baruah, 2007) .  ... 
doi:10.1016/j.jss.2013.09.029 fatcat:ukqvwofzyjgwdavogb7qs3usaq

A Multicore Processor based Real-Time System for Automobile management application [article]

Vaidehi. M., T.R. Gopalakrishnan Nair
2010 arXiv   pre-print
The industry available real time operating system is used for scheduling various tasks and jobs on the multicore processor.  ...  The modeling of the automobile tasks with real time commitments, organizing appropriate scheduling for various real time tasks and the usage of a multicore processor enables the system to realize higher  ...  Total Engineering, Analysis and Manufacturing Technologies 3-8PAGES A Multicore Processor based Real-Time System for Automobile management application.  ... 
arXiv:1001.3716v1 fatcat:ntbk4yajljhsvnmihrygqye4rm

Combining Dataflow Applications and Real-time Task Sets on Multi-core Platforms

Hazem Ismail Ali, Benny Akesson, Luís Miguel Pinho
2017 Proceedings of the 20th International Workshop on Software and Compilers for Embedded Systems - SCOPES '17  
Future real-time embedded systems will increasingly incorporate mixed application models with timing constraints running on the same multi-core platform.  ...  ABSTRACT Future real-time embedded systems will increasingly incorporate mixed application models with timing constraints running on the same multi-core platform.  ...  ACKNOWLEDGMENTS This work was partially supported by National Funds through FCT/MEC (Portuguese Foundation for Science and Technology), under PhD grant SFRH/BD/79872/2011 and co-nanced by ERDF (European  ... 
doi:10.1145/3078659.3078671 dblp:conf/scopes/AliAP17 fatcat:oymbuo6iingi7h4umlndt4npue

Work-in-Progress: Design-Space Exploration of Multi-Core Processors for Safety-Critical Real-Time Systems

Dolly Sapra, Sebastian Altmeyer
2017 2017 IEEE Real-Time Systems Symposium (RTSS)  
The automated exploration builds upon Mulitcore Response Time Analysis for timing verification and multicube for heuristic search methods.  ...  Multi-core architectures provide better computational abilities, but at the same time complicate the computation of timing bounds.  ...  In this paper, we sketch a design-space exploration for safety-critical real-time multi-core systems.  ... 
doi:10.1109/rtss.2017.00040 dblp:conf/rtss/SapraA17 fatcat:l4mfonc4ezgoliwsc5nso3mczu

Multi-core composability in the face of memory-bus contention

Moris Behnam, Rafia Inam, Thomas Nolte, Mikael Sjödin
2013 ACM SIGBED Review  
We evaluate existing work for achieving real-time predictability on multi-cores and illustrate their lack with respect to composability.  ...  To address composability we present a multi-resource server-based scheduling technique to provide predictable performance when composing multiple subsystems on a shared multi-core platform.  ...  [14] where they provide a response-time analysis for COTS based multi-core systems and they solve the problem of interleaving cache effects by using non-preemptive task scheduling.  ... 
doi:10.1145/2544350.2544354 fatcat:wzsko7qqhjd67kmpoiiuentqyy

Higher Utilization of Multi-Core Processors in Dynamic Real-Time Software Systems

Thomas Hanti
2013 International Journal of Electrical Energy  
Our paper will present the design of a new scheduling approach, the Hierarchical Asynchronous Multi-Core Scheduler (HAMS), for real-time Electronic Control Units.  ...  In order to provide the necessary calculating power, more and more multi-core processors will be used in Embedded Electronic Control Units.  ...  In order to further optimize the usage of the embedded real-time multi-core systems we propose a new approach in multi-core real-time scheduling.  ... 
doi:10.12720/ijoee.1.4.249-255 fatcat:j646372wjffkfmx5shhukpkri4

A Survey of Timing Verification Techniques for Multi-Core Real-Time Systems

Claire Maiza, Hamza Rihani, Juan M. Rivas, Joël Goossens, Sebastian Altmeyer, Robert I. Davis
2019 ACM Computing Surveys  
This survey provides an overview of the scientiic literature on timing veriication techniques for multi-core real-time systems.  ...  The survey highlights the key issues involved in providing guarantees of timing correctness for multi-core systems.  ...  research on analysis of NoCs.  ... 
doi:10.1145/3323212 fatcat:mn6xmduiyjfgzhemn5s2lmfgje

Multicore partitioned systems based on hypervisor

A. Crespo, M. Masmano, J. Coronel, S. Peiró, P. Balbastre, J. Simó
2014 IFAC Proceedings Volumes  
The paper analyse the design and implementation of XtratuM for multi-core and details a performance analysis to determine the overheads incurred by the virtualization layer and presents some results when  ...  In this paper, we present a multi-core hypervisor for mixed-criticality applications as one of the results of the MultiPARTES project.  ...  A multi-core partition can allocate a thread to core under a cyclic scheduling and other thread to a core under a priority based schedule. • Real CPUs can be scheduled under different scheduling policies  ... 
doi:10.3182/20140824-6-za-1003.02410 fatcat:j7y4a67p3zfxtlfdx2s4cneciq

Performance Preservation Using Servers for Predictable Execution and Integration

Rafia Inam
2014 2014 IEEE 38th Annual Computer Software and Applications Conference  
Further, we provide the schedulability analysis for MRS to provide predictable performance when composing multiple components on a shared multi-core platform.  ...  Proof-of-concept case studies executed on an AVR based 32-bit micro-controller demonstrates the preserving of real-time properties within components for predictable integration and reusability in a new  ...  Secondly, to analyze that the multi-resource servers provide composable hierarchical scheduling on multi-core platforms, we extend traditional schedulabity analysis for the multiresource server.  ... 
doi:10.1109/compsac.2014.42 dblp:conf/compsac/Inam14 fatcat:hjjtqjlcajgabm74pm4ioa5v7i

A Real-Time Scheduling Framework Based on Multi-core Dynamic Partitioning in Virtualized Environment [chapter]

Song Wu, Like Zhou, Danqing Fu, Hai Jin, Xuanhua Shi
2014 Lecture Notes in Computer Science  
Aiming at these problems, this paper presents a real-time scheduling framework based on multi-core dynamic partitioning.  ...  Conclusion In this paper, we present a real-time scheduling framework based on multi-core dynamic partitioning in virtualized environment.  ... 
doi:10.1007/978-3-662-44917-2_17 fatcat:pw3emmuamvhlhnjylhlxxndtxq

Compositional schedulability analysis for cyber-physical systems

Arvind Easwaran, Insup Lee
2008 ACM SIGBED Review  
It is desirable that these systems operate correctly, efficiently and in real-time. Composition for CPSs.  ...  Component-based engineering, which involves compositional system modeling and analysis, is widely used for this purpose.  ...  Component-based real-time CPSs often involve hierarchical scheduling frameworks that support resource sharing among components under different scheduling algorithms.  ... 
doi:10.1145/1366283.1366289 fatcat:hywzwhku5bferg4soqottdirbu

SPARTS: Simulator for Power Aware and Real-Time Systems

Borislav Nikolic, Muhammad Ali Awan, Stefan M. Petters
2011 2011IEEE 10th International Conference on Trust, Security and Privacy in Computing and Communications  
Additionally, efficient scheduling algorithms, as proven through analyses and simulations, often impose requirements that have significant run-time cost, specially in the context of multi-core systems.  ...  Additionally, efficient scheduling algorithms, as proven through analyses and simulations, often impose requirements that have significant run-time cost, specially in the context of multi-core systems.  ...  The EE can easily be extended for multi-core scheduling algorithms.  ... 
doi:10.1109/trustcom.2011.137 dblp:conf/trustcom/NikolicAP11 fatcat:ge2izz4gxvgmzliaajqborv5oq

A Survey on Scheduling Approaches for Hard Real-Time Systems

Mehrin Rouhifar, Reza Ravanmehr
2015 International Journal of Computer Applications  
In this paper, main scheduling algorithms for hard real-time systems (RTSs) have been investigated that include both uni and multi processors schemes.  ...  Finally, the analysis and evaluation of the mentioned methods are shown based on the schedulability of task sets and efficiency.  ...  For memory-centric real-time scheduling using PREM (PRedictable Execution Model), is assumed the hard real-time system is scheduled on partitioned multi-core platform which tasks are statically allocated  ... 
doi:10.5120/ijca2015907656 fatcat:na7u3dgqsjhphl253ecd22jkau

Multiprocessor Scheduling meets the Industrial Wireless

Miguel Gutiérrez-Gaitán, Patrick Meumeu Yomsi
2019 U Porto Journal of Engineering  
This survey covers schedulability analysis approaches that have been recently proposed for multi-hop and multi-channel wireless sensor and actuator networks in the industrial control process domain.  ...  The paper address the mapping of multi-channel transmission scheduling to multiprocessor scheduling theory, and recognize it as the key aspect of the research direction covered by this survey.  ...  Acknowledgments This work was partially supported by National Funds through FCT/MCTES (Portuguese Foundation for Science and Technology), within the CISTER Research Unit (UID/CEC/04234).  ... 
doi:10.24840/2183-6493_005.001_0005 fatcat:5bggoajd2vgf5amzah3ygxmp7a

Parallelism-Aware Memory Interference Delay Analysis for COTS Multicore Systems

Heechul Yun, Rodolfo Pellizzon, Prathap Kumar Valsan
2015 2015 27th Euromicro Conference on Real-Time Systems  
"Bounding Memory Interference Delay in COTS-based Multi-Core Systems," RTAS'14  ...  -Delay analysis • Evaluation • Conclusion 16 System Model • Task -Solo execution time C -Memory demand (#of LLC misses): H • Core Delay Analysis • Goal -Compute the worst-case memory  ... 
doi:10.1109/ecrts.2015.24 dblp:conf/ecrts/YunPV15 fatcat:jplxqtxrjvhvtnaojn56rtxbti
« Previous Showing results 1 — 15 out of 98,039 results